Job Description:
As our new Senior Financial Operations Manager, you will play a pivotal role in shaping the financial strategy and driving operational excellence across the account, leveraging your expertise in financial oversight, strategic decision-making, and efficiency optimisation to ensure the company’s ongoing financial health and effective resource utilisation.
This role is primarily home-based, with occasional travel — typically no more than once a week to the Holborn London office, and infrequent in-person meetings in Pimlico or Bracknell — with all travel expenses reimbursed.
Key Responsibilities:
Strategic & Leadership Responsibilities
- Financial Strategy Development: Lead the development of financial strategies to support long-term business objectives, ensuring alignment with overall company goals.
- Senior Stakeholder Engagement: Partner with C-suite executives, department heads, and key stakeholders to drive financial and operational efficiency across the organisation.
- Team Leadership & Development: Mentor and oversee a team of financial analysts and operations specialists, fostering a culture of high performance, accuracy, and continuous improvement.
Financial Oversight & Operational Excellence
- End-to-End Financial Operations Management: Ensure robust financial governance by overseeing all aspects of financial operations, including forecasting, reporting, and budget control.
- Advanced Data Analysis & Forecasting: Utilise financial models and predictive analytics to anticipate market trends, mitigate risks, and inform business decision-making.
- Operational Efficiency & Process Optimisation: Identify and implement process improvements, leveraging technology and automation to enhance productivity and reduce inefficiencies.
Cost Management & Compliance
- Budget Control & Cost Optimisation: Own the financial planning process, working closely with leadership to drive cost-saving initiatives and improve profit margins.
- Freelance & Vendor Management: Establish governance around freelancer engagement, ensuring cost-effectiveness and alignment with project scopes and company policies.
- Compliance & Risk Management: Ensure adherence to financial regulations, company policies, and best practices, mitigating risks and maintaining financial integrity.
Reporting & Performance Tracking
- Advanced Utilisation & Performance Reporting: Develop and present high-level financial performance reports, ensuring insights are actionable for business growth.
- Audit & Financial Integrity: Oversee internal and external audits, ensuring financial data accuracy and regulatory compliance.
- Resource Allocation & Optimisation: Implement data-driven strategies for workforce planning, balancing operational needs with financial constraints.
Requirements
- Financial & Business Acumen: Strong understanding of P&L management, budgeting, forecasting, and strategic financial planning.
- Analytical & Problem-Solving Skills: Proven ability to interpret complex financial data and translate insights into actionable business strategies.
- Leadership & Team Management: Demonstrated experience in leading high-performing teams and driving a culture of excellence.
- Stakeholder Management: Excellent interpersonal skills with the ability to influence, collaborate with, and manage relationships with senior stakeholders and cross-functional teams.
- Technical Proficiency: Advanced skills in financial and operational systems such as SAP, Excel, ERPs, Power BI, and Tableau.
- Change Management: Experience in leading operational change initiatives, including process automation and business transformation.
- Education: Bachelor's degree required, ideally in Finance, Accounting, Business, or a related field.
- Experience: Minimum of 5 years in financial operations or a related role, with preference for candidates who have managed project-based financials and held operational leadership responsibilities.
